趣味プログラミングblog
VBAなどのプログラムソースを公開しています。 皆様の業務改善につながればうれしいです。
【エクセル関数】vlookupやmatch関数で、1つ目じゃない値を引っ張る方法
2022年03月29日
vlookup関数やmatch関数は、検索文字にHITした行を探してくれて便利。
ただ、検索文字が複数行にあって、2つ目以降に登場すると簡単には取ってこれない。
今回は、特定のキーワードのある行以降の検索文字を拾ってくるものを作ってみた。
なお、キーワードとして検索文字を設定すると、2つ目に登場した検索文字を拾える。
=VLOOKUP("小計",OFFSET(C1:D13,MATCH("Bさん",C:C,0),0),2,0)
C列の"Bさん"より下にある"小計"を探して、1列右側の値を拾ってくる関数
詳細は図を参照。
PR
Comment
Name:
Subject:
Mail:
URL:
Decoration:
Black
LimeGreen
SeaGreen
Teal
FireBrick
Tomato
IndianRed
BurlyWood
SlateGray
DarkSlateBlue
LightPink
DeepPink
DarkOrange
Gold
DimGray
Silver
Comment:
Pass:
«
フォルダがなければ作るスクリプト
|
HOME
|
Zipファイルと空フォルダを消すクリーナバッチ
»
プロフィール
HN:
ジョー
性別:
男性
職業:
会社員
自己紹介:
元社内SEのジョーです。
記事一覧
を作りました。ご活用ください。
カテゴリー
VBA(83)
エクセル(15)
VBScript(36)
雑記(30)
cmd,bat(21)
未選択(0)
電気回路(1)
健康(0)
料理(6)
ツール(3)
windows(6)
Uipath(6)
レビュー(1)
Word VBA(10)
iPhone(9)
mobile(11)
Certification(5)
PowerShell(1)
最新記事
クリップボード内の文字列を置換するスクリプトg
(10/21)
テキストファイルの頻出行を調べるPowerShell
(10/03)
windows11の右クリックメニューをwindows10の仕様に戻した話
(09/20)
ファイル名にメモを添えてバックアップフォルダにコピーするスクリプト
(09/19)
otbedit の色分け設定ファイル(PowerShell用)を作った話
(09/11)
RSS
RSS 0.91
RSS 1.0
RSS 2.0
リンク
管理画面
新しい記事を書く
P R